About the End Client

The end client is a large enterprise organisation operating within a complex, highly governed environment. This role supports an internal operational capability uplift—building a targeted Power Apps solution that enables better monitoring, investigation, and management of production job executions for technical support teams.

About the Role

An exciting opportunity exists for a Power Apps Tech Lead to own and lead delivery of a Power Apps user interface integrated to a SQL Server-based job execution framework database. This is a single-person technical leadership role, where you will guide development (including offshore build support) and ensure a clean, scalable solution that future engineering teams can extend.

You’ll build functionality that empowers L2/L3 Production Support teams to search, monitor, and manage job executions—providing intuitive screens to track job status, investigate failures, and manage execution records.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ead development end-to-end (including guiding offshore development) for a Power Apps solution integrated with a SQL-based framework database.
  • Build features for Production Support (L2/L3) teams to search, monitor, and manage job execution outcomes.
  • Design simple, efficient UI screens for internal users to track job status, investigate failures, and manage execution records.
  • Integrate Power Apps with SQL Server to query, display, and update job execution data.
  • Ensure code is clean, maintainable, and extensible so engineering teams can add components in future.  
  • Apply Power Apps best practices and enterprise coding standards including reusable components, error handling, and performance optimisation.
  • Work within full SDLC expectations—from design through build, test, deployment, and handover.
Required Skills & Experience

  • 5–6+ years experience in Microsoft Power Apps / Power Platform development.
  • Strong capability designing and building Power Apps UI experiences for internal enterprise users.
  • Experience integrating Power Apps with SQL Server(data retrieval, updates, operational reporting views).
  • Strong understanding of Power Apps development best practices, including: reusable components, code optimisation, structured error handling, and collaboration/co-development approaches.
  • Experience supporting or building operational dashboards and/or solutions aligned to job execution frameworks.
  • Comfortable operating as a single lead, coordinating delivery activities and ensuring engineering-quality outputs.
